首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何访问搜索栏点击回调

访问搜索栏点击回调是指在一个网页或应用程序中,当用户点击搜索栏时触发的事件。以下是一个完善且全面的答案:

访问搜索栏点击回调是通过添加事件监听器来实现的。事件监听器会在用户点击搜索栏时执行特定的回调函数。这样,开发者可以在回调函数中编写自定义的代码,实现与搜索栏点击相关的功能。

访问搜索栏点击回调的实现步骤如下:

  1. 首先,需要获取到搜索栏的DOM元素。可以使用HTML的标签选择器或JavaScript的getElementById()等方法获取到搜索栏的元素。
  2. 然后,使用JavaScript的addEventListener()方法为搜索栏元素添加点击事件的监听器。这个方法需要传入两个参数:要监听的事件类型(如'click')和回调函数。
  3. 在回调函数中,可以编写代码来实现搜索栏点击时的操作。例如,可以展开搜索建议下拉列表、显示搜索历史记录、跳转到搜索结果页面等。

以下是一个示例代码,展示了如何使用JavaScript实现搜索栏点击回调:

代码语言:txt
复制
// 获取搜索栏元素
var searchInput = document.getElementById('search-bar');

// 添加点击事件监听器
searchInput.addEventListener('click', function(event) {
  // 在这里编写搜索栏点击时的操作代码
  console.log('搜索栏被点击了');
});

在这个示例中,我们通过getElementById()方法获取到了id为'search-bar'的搜索栏元素,并使用addEventListener()方法为它添加了一个点击事件的监听器。当用户点击搜索栏时,控制台会输出一条消息。

应用场景: 搜索栏点击回调功能可以广泛应用于各种网页和应用程序中,以提供更好的用户体验。例如,在电子商务网站中,可以使用搜索栏点击回调来展示搜索建议、智能补全搜索关键词、快速跳转到搜索结果等。在社交媒体应用中,可以使用搜索栏点击回调来显示热门话题、搜索用户、搜索相关内容等。

腾讯云相关产品和产品介绍链接地址: 腾讯云提供了一系列云计算产品,包括云服务器、云数据库、云存储等,以满足用户的各种需求。具体关于腾讯云产品的信息和介绍,可以参考腾讯云官方网站:腾讯云

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券